1. Lid Lock - Manually operated lock that prevents opening of fryer lid prior to
release of pressure through lid valve.
2. Handlebar - Used to raise and lower lid and secure lid to lid lock block.
3. Lid - Pressurizes fryer when lowered and locked in place with heated cooking
oil in cookpot.
4. Warning Label Panel - Instructions intended to advise operators of potential
hazards involved when using fryer.
5. Cookpot - Stainless steel vessel which holds heated cooking oil.
6. Lid Lock Block - Captures lid lock and handlebar assembly. Supports basket
drain hook when draining fryer basket.
7. High Limit Thermostat Manual Reset Button - (located behind small metal
plug) Used to reset the thermostat in the event that the High Limit Thermostat
Lamp turns ON. DANGER: If the High Limit Thermostat Lamp turns ON it may
indicate a serious problem with your fryer. To reset the High Limit Thermostat,
allow the cooking oil to cool to below 375˚F (191˚C). Press in the High Limit
Reset button. When the cooking oil heats up, if the High Limit Thermostat
Lamps turns ON again, turn the fryer power switch OFF, disconnect fryer from
power, and call a service technician for repair. If the High Limit Thermostat
Lamp tends to turn On frequently, call a service technician for repair.
